Why Local Readers Care About Space Stories

Space science can feel distant, but great writing connects it to everyday life in local communities. When a community learns how research improves navigation, communications, and weather understanding, space topics become more than entertainment. Writers can space articles also highlight how local universities, observatories, planetariums, and science clubs contribute to real discoveries and public learning. That local lens helps readers see themselves as part of the scientific conversation.

Local relevance also improves how articles are discovered and shared. Readers are more likely to engage when the content references nearby institutions, regional learning programs, or local challenges that space technology can address. For example, communities that invest in STEM education may value articles that explain how satellite data supports agriculture, flood monitoring, and public safety. By framing each story around practical connections, space coverage becomes more actionable and easier to discuss in school and community settings.

Making Research Understandable Without Losing Accuracy

Strong space writing balances clarity with scientific integrity, especially when serving readers who are new to astronomy. One effective approach is to translate research goals into everyday questions, such as how scientists detect faint signals or confirm that an object is a planet. Instead of focusing only on complex methods, the article can explain what the method helps solve and what evidence supports the conclusion. This keeps readers engaged while still respecting the rigor of peer-reviewed work.

Another way to earn trust is to describe uncertainty in a simple, honest manner. Many discoveries involve probabilities, measurement limits, and follow-up observations, and local readers benefit from understanding why additional data matters. A good article can outline what scientists have measured, what remains unclear, and how future observations reduce ambiguity. When you present this structure clearly, the audience feels informed rather than overwhelmed.

Turning Discoveries Into Community Learning Opportunities

Local relevance can be strengthened by pairing discovery narratives with learning activities that fit community schedules and resources. For instance, an article can suggest simple observation ideas like identifying bright planets, using binoculars for lunar features, or comparing star charts with the night sky. It can also recommend accessible formats for discussion, such as classroom prompts, community Q&A questions, or reading groups that follow up with hands-on models. These options help readers transform curiosity into participation, which is the foundation of sustained interest.

Space stories can also support practical local interests by explaining how space-based tools apply to local concerns. Satellite imagery and orbital observations relate to wildfire risk assessment, air quality monitoring, and infrastructure planning, which makes the content resonate beyond astronomy. An article can connect these applications to everyday decision-making, such as how communities interpret alerts or how schools use data for science projects. When readers see direct value, they are more likely to return to future articles and share them with neighbors.
